M.2 NVMe SSD and SATA 2.5 inch SSD are two different types of solid-state drives (SSDs) that are used to store data in computers. The main differences between them are:
- Connection: A SATA 2.5 inch SSD connects to the motherboard using a SATA cable, while an M.2 NVMe SSD connects directly to the motherboard using an M.2 interface.
- Speed: M.2 NVMe SSDs typically offer much faster data transfer speeds than SATA 2.5 inch SSDs. This is because M.2 NVMe SSDs use the NVMe (Non-Volatile Memory Express) protocol, which is designed specifically for SSDs and takes advantage of the direct connection to the motherboard to offer faster speeds. SATA 2.5 inch SSDs, on the other hand, are limited by the SATA III interface and the speeds it can provide.
- Form factor: SATA 2.5 inch SSDs are larger in size and have a physical form factor of a 2.5 inch disk drive, while M.2 NVMe SSDs are much smaller and take up less space on the motherboard.
- Power consumption: M.2 NVMe SSDs generally consume less power than SATA 2.5 inch SSDs, making them a good choice for laptops and other devices where battery life is a concern.
Overall, M.2 NVMe SSDs offer faster performance and a smaller form factor compared to SATA 2.5 inch SSDs. However, SATA 2.5 inch SSDs are still a good choice for those who need a lot of storage space and don’t require the high-speed performance offered by M.2 NVMe SSDs.
